Dress Up Your Dog This Halloween

According to the National Retail Federation, last year an estimated one out of ten people (or 7.4 million households) put their beloved pet in a kind of costume with devil and pumpkin costumes the most popular. Many people who own pets think of them as family members and go all out to include dogs, cats and other animals in their Halloween festivities. Here is a list of the top 10 animal costumes in the past year:


Devil
Pumpkin
Witch
Princess
Angel
Pirate
Hot Dog
Bat
Black Cat
Clown
